Funnel Cake Express provides Toronto wedding funnel cake catering through mobile food trucks and an indoor or outdoor dessert station. Its official website identifies weddings as one of the events it serves and describes freshly prepared funnel cakes, signature topping combinations and several deep-fried desserts. The business also offers frozen funnel cake kits, although couples considering on-site wedding service will likely be most interested in the private event truck or live-station formats.

The current official site confirms that Funnel Cake Express was established in 2005 and is based on Steeles Avenue West in Toronto. Its stated coverage includes Toronto and communities across the Greater Toronto Area. Services and specialization

Funnel Cake Express specializes in made-to-order funnel cakes and carnival-style deep-fried desserts for events. The private event truck is expressly presented as suitable for weddings, birthdays, corporate parties, school events and neighbourhood gatherings. For venues where a truck is impractical or not permitted, the company offers a self-contained funnel cake station that can be installed indoors or outdoors.

The official menu lists three signature funnel cakes. The Steam Engine has cinnamon, icing sugar and a choice of sauce; the Locomotion adds fresh strawberries; and the fully loaded Bullet also includes vanilla soft serve. Listed deep-fried choices include funnel fries, Oreos, Mars bars, Snickers and Reese’s. Couples should request the current event menu because the public menu describes products rather than confirming which selections are included in a wedding package.

Four service formats appear on the booking page: a festival truck, a private event truck, an indoor or outdoor station, and frozen funnel cake kits. The festival truck has a stated minimum of 300 orders. The private event truck and station each have a minimum of 50 orders.

Service area and who it may suit

The official website says the company serves Toronto, Vaughan, Mississauga, Brampton and other GTA locations. Its broader service description also names Markham and Scarborough. Availability for a particular venue should still be confirmed, especially when travel, parking or setup constraints could affect the service plan.

This may suit couples who want dessert prepared in view of their guests, a carnival-inspired alternative to a conventional plated dessert, or a separate sweet service during the reception. The station can be relevant for indoor venues or properties without suitable food-truck access. Because the two private-event formats begin at 50 orders, the service is less clearly documented for weddings needing fewer portions; couples below that threshold should ask whether kits or another arrangement are possible.

Confirmed strengths and practical limitations

A documented strength is the choice between a mobile truck and an indoor or outdoor station. The company says the station service brings the necessary equipment, ingredients and toppings, while the booking page notes that extra items such as tables or power sources can be arranged at additional cost when required. Funnel cakes from the private event truck are described as being prepared fresh to order.

Another practical feature is the clearly published order threshold for each main service format. This helps couples identify whether the private truck, station or larger festival truck is the relevant starting point before requesting a quote. The public menu also gives couples a useful view of the signature funnel cakes and deep-fried items they can discuss with the company.

The limitations are primarily gaps in the public information. The site does not provide wedding-specific package inclusions, service durations, staffing ratios, travel fees, deposit terms, cancellation terms or detailed dietary and allergen guidance. It also does not confirm that every public-menu item is available for every private event. These are matters to settle directly rather than assumptions about what a booking includes.

What couples should confirm

Before signing, confirm that the selected format is permitted by the venue. A food truck may require an accessible parking and service position, while an indoor station may need designated floor space, ventilation approval and access to suitable power. The company’s site says power-source and table rentals may be arranged at extra cost, so responsibility for each requirement should appear in the quote.

Ask for the current private-event menu, exact portion count, toppings, serving window and plan for guests with allergies or dietary restrictions. Couples should also establish arrival and setup times, cleanup responsibilities, travel charges, weather contingencies for outdoor service, deposit and cancellation rules, and what happens if the final guest count changes. None of those terms is sufficiently detailed on the public website.
